The book "Metal Fatigue and the Tasks of Mechanical Engineering" by I. A. Odinga is a fascinating and in-depth study that immerses the reader in the world of materials science and mechanical engineering. This work will be a real find for students, engineers and anyone interested in the physics of materials and their behavior under load. The book discusses in detail the processes of metal fatigue, which is a key aspect to ensure the reliability and durability of structures in various industries. The author focuses on the mechanisms that lead to fatigue of metals, and their impact on the performance of products . Odinga not only explains the theoretical foundations, but also illustrates them with examples from real practice. The reader will be able to learn about how various factors, such as temperature, loading rate, and chemical composition, affect the fatigue properties of materials. This knowledge is extremely important for engineers working on the design and analysis of mechanical systems, because the safety and efficiency of machines and structures depend on it.
